spaxel/dashboard/css
jedarden bc5ebc0028 feat(dashboard): implement command palette with fuzzy search and time navigation
Ctrl+K / Cmd+K universal search interface for expert mode with:
- Fuzzy matching (prefix, substring, word-level, subsequence)
- Time navigation via @ prefix (@3am, @yesterday 11pm, @this morning, @last night)
- 36 commands across navigation, view, system, security, appearance, actions, help
- Entity search across zones, people, nodes, events
- Recent history with localStorage persistence
- Expert-mode gating (disabled in simple/ambient modes)
- Keyboard navigation (arrow keys, Enter, Escape, Tab)
- Toolbar shortcut hint with platform-aware display (⌘K on Mac)

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com>
2026-04-24 17:36:14 -04:00
..
_fix_html.py style(dashboard): complete CSS tokenization and add live-view grid layout classes 2026-04-24 15:14:40 -04:00
_tokenize.py style(dashboard): complete CSS tokenization and add live-view grid layout classes 2026-04-24 15:14:40 -04:00
ambient.css style(dashboard): continue design token migration across remaining CSS 2026-04-24 16:41:18 -04:00
anomaly.css style(dashboard): continue design token migration across remaining CSS 2026-04-24 16:41:18 -04:00
apdetection.css style(dashboard): complete design token migration and live view cleanup 2026-04-24 16:39:53 -04:00
ble-panel.css fix(dashboard): repair CSS syntax errors and complete token migration 2026-04-24 16:57:32 -04:00
briefing.css style(dashboard): continue design token migration across remaining CSS 2026-04-24 16:41:18 -04:00
command-palette.css feat(dashboard): implement command palette with fuzzy search and time navigation 2026-04-24 17:36:14 -04:00
expert.css style(dashboard): continue design token migration across remaining CSS 2026-04-24 16:41:18 -04:00
explainability.css fix(dashboard): repair CSS syntax errors and complete token migration 2026-04-24 16:57:32 -04:00
fleet-page.css style(dashboard): continue design token migration across remaining CSS 2026-04-24 16:41:18 -04:00
floorplan.css style(dashboard): continue design token migration across remaining CSS 2026-04-24 16:41:18 -04:00
guided-help.css fix(dashboard): repair CSS syntax errors and complete token migration 2026-04-24 16:57:32 -04:00
home.css fix(dashboard): center home page max-width containers 2026-04-24 17:12:45 -04:00
integrations.css style(dashboard): adopt Radix dark design tokens across all CSS files 2026-04-24 16:04:42 -04:00
layout.css fix(dashboard): repair CSS syntax errors and complete token migration 2026-04-24 16:57:32 -04:00
notifications.css fix(dashboard): repair CSS syntax errors and complete token migration 2026-04-24 16:57:32 -04:00
panels.css fix(dashboard): repair CSS syntax errors and complete token migration 2026-04-24 16:57:32 -04:00
quick-actions.css fix(dashboard): repair CSS syntax errors and complete token migration 2026-04-24 16:57:32 -04:00
replay.css fix(dashboard): repair CSS syntax errors and complete token migration 2026-04-24 16:57:32 -04:00
security.css style(dashboard): continue design token migration across remaining CSS 2026-04-24 16:41:18 -04:00
simple.css fix(dashboard): repair CSS syntax errors and complete token migration 2026-04-24 16:57:32 -04:00
simulator.css fix(dashboard): repair CSS syntax errors and complete token migration 2026-04-24 16:57:32 -04:00
sleep.css style(dashboard): continue design token migration across remaining CSS 2026-04-24 16:41:18 -04:00
timeline.css fix(dashboard): repair CSS syntax errors and complete token migration 2026-04-24 16:57:32 -04:00
tokens.css fix(dashboard): repair CSS syntax errors and complete token migration 2026-04-24 16:57:32 -04:00
troubleshoot.css style(dashboard): continue design token migration across remaining CSS 2026-04-24 16:41:18 -04:00
wizard.css style(dashboard): extract inline styles to tokenized CSS files 2026-04-24 15:47:33 -04:00